Renee "Ren" Miller was five when her Dad left to go to the shops and never came back.

Left to grow up with a cancer riddled mother, things have never been easy for a teenager who had to be wise beyond her years. Then one day they lose the battle and she’s all alone.

Now twenty-two, Ren reluctantly goes to find her estranged father. He owns the down and out boxing studio, Beat, and Ren finds herself drawn to the ring. She thrives on learning a new way of fighting a life that kept kicking her down…instead of struggling against the current, she kicks it right between the legs.

Then one day, Ash Fuller, her Dad's star fighter comes back to town. Mysterious, handsome… Dangerous… Everything Ren doesn't need.

But he's got other ideas…

…and so does she.

Amity Cross is the author of wicked stories about rock stars looking for redemption, gritty romances featuring MMA fighters and dark tales of forbidden romance. She loves to write about alpha males and the strong women who challenge them to fall in love.
Amity lives in a leafy country town near Melbourne, Australia and can be found chained to her desk, held at ransom by her characters.
Don’t send help. She likes it.

2.5 stars rounded up to 3. This started off well. A girl leaves home to find her estranged father after her mother dies. She's angry with her father because he left them, but she really has no other choice. Her father owns a gym that trains MMA fighters and give classes on self defense and MMA fighting. He unenthusiastically (he has a second family) takes her in and gives her a small room to stay in at the gym. She starts taking MMA classes and uses the facilities the gym offers.

A former big time MMA fighter who had brought the gym to prominence but eventually got himself booted out of the MMA league and has now been gone years, shows up again at the gym. He has lots of anger and lots of secrets but he takes it upon himself to help the girl train at the gym. They first form a friendship (although she is panting and drooling everytime she is around him). But he refuses to share his secrets and reasons for his uncontrollable anger. Then a sexual relationship develops but not much develops on the secrets front (other than some down and dirty underground MMA fighting that the girl also gets involved in).

And then, a CLIFFHANGER! Yes, book #2 will be on its way later. We still don't know the answers about our MMA fighter and now he has disappeared, leaving our girl behind. I'm not even sure that we will get the answers to the secrets in book #2 and I hate to say it but I don't know if I care. Sorry.

Ren is a girl who has been left behind by her father, when she was 5 years old. She was left to take care of her dying mother, all alone. When her mother does pass away, her last request is for Ren to go find her father.

“Six months ago, my Mum died. Six months ago, I was left totally alone in the world. I worked my whole life to care for my beautiful, optimistic, cancer riddled mother when everyone else had just upped and left us like it was all just a little too hard.”

When she does find her father, it is at “Beat” training gym. Her father is the owner. He sets her up in a storage room, since she has no where to go, and his new family doesn’t want to know about her. Ren tries to make the best of the situation, by using his gym after dark to learn to fight. When Ash, her father’s prize fighter, shows back up after years away, Ren’s life is thrown off course.

Ash and Ren do not hit it off well. They bicker constantly, and avoid each other as much as they can. Ren is completely attracted to him, but is fighting it….she doesn’t need another person to abandon her. When Ash finds Ren training after hours, he decides to help her. But, he throws her mixed signals, and leaves Ren feeling unwanted.

“Just by being here I was hurting her because I knew she was attracted to me, but what she didn’t know was that I was attracted to her. I didn’t just want to f*** her, I wanted to know her and that was a mind f*** in itself. Nothing good would come out of that.”

Every night Ash trains alone with Ren, but during the day he flirts with her b****y half- sister, who can’t stand her. He sleeps in Ren’s bed after each training, but only holds her, and is gone before she wakes in the morning. Just when Ren has had enough, things change, and he kisses her. Slowly things begin to change, and Ren and Ash start a relationship. The people who look out for Ren are worried that he will hurt her. Ash has a dark side, and sometimes can’t control his “beast” side.

“You could say getting to know Ren had sparked something in my dead heart, or I could’ve just grown the f*** up over the past four years. Who knew?”

Even though they started a relationship, Ash always disappears for a few hours every night, before coming back to train with Ren alone. When Ren finally gets Ash to tell her more, and come clean, she learns he is fighting at Underground fights. Ash doesn’t want her to be a part of that world, but Ren needs an outlet for her aggression, and fighting in a cage might just be the answer. Seems Ren and Ash are similar in their need to fight out their problems. But, diving into the Underground world, especially when your boyfriend is the champion, could be scary and harmful. Especially when people want to take him down, and will use anyone to get to him. When Ren is threatened, will Ash stick around, or will he leave?

I enjoyed the idea of this story, and all the different characters. Ren is a girl you want to believe in. I felt some story lines were a little flat, but definitely a good read, and can’t wait for book two.

Didn't finish after page 55. This book has way too many romance novel cliches that drive me crazy. For starters, I hate when authors make the lead female bitchy, uptight, and rude in an attempt to make her seem tough or badass. It's so annoying! I see it all the time. Are authors really that unimaginative that they don't know any other way to portray a tough girl other than to make her just be angry and snippy all the time?! Like when she first meets the love interest, ash, she treats him like he murdered her puppy or something. She hates him immediately and makes it known to him at every interaction. Yeah he's cocky and a little obnoxious toward her when they first meet but nothing to justify her being so rude all the time. Another common cliche that annoys me is when the love interests constantly try to talk themselves out of liking/going after the love interest. Now I can appreciate this scenario as a plot conflict to a point. But it has to be done with a lot more finesse than this author was able to do. Another cliche I hate is when the guy is "uncharacteristically" more interested in the girl more than any other girl ever after only having just met her. Especially when the girl has a personality about as fun as a bag of bricks. Why can't the author have the girl do things to make me see why the guy would think she was unique and different. And soooooo many authors do all of these exact same things I just do. Not. Get. It!!! Everything out of all of the characters mouths are so expected and obvious. I like when characters are more unique and respond to stuff in a way you wouldn't always expect.
